What happens when I come for an appointment?

We will have sent you a medical questionnaire beforehand to give you plenty of time to fill it out at home.

The therapist will go through your information, explain the procedure, and if appropriate continue with the treatment.

The colonic itself takes about 40 minutes during which time water is gently introduced into the colon via the rectum. The therapist may also use special massage techniques to stimulate the release of stored matter. Your modesty is preserved at all times.

The therapist can also advise you of any dietary changes which will help to enhance your treatment. At the end of the treatment we give you a probiotic to maintain the good bacteria in your bowel and support your immune system.

How large is the tube?

A lot smaller than everyone anticipates! The speculum is inserted about an inch into the body and is actually quite comfortable.


How often should I have a colonic treatment?

It very much depends on your reason for wanting colonics in the first place. On average, most people find that at least two treatments within two weeks is best to start off with.

During your first treatment you will have approximately 10 gallons of water gently washed in and out, and the therapist will use various water temperatures to see what works best for you.

On your second treatment you will have a between 15 and 20 gallons as your body is more used to the detox.

After that your therapist will recommend when, and if, further treatments are required. Although colonics are not habit forming we prefer not to treat you too often, preferring to give you advice on how you can maintain a healthy colon at home.

Is there anyone who shouldn't have a colonic?

Anyone with any ongoing medical issues should check with us before making an appointment. The most common conditions that would preclude you from having a colonic are high or low blood pressure, severe anaemia, ulcerative colitis, bleeding piles, anal fissures, some recent surgical procedures or pregnancy.
